Warsaw: Huge Victory for Tenants!
Submitted by libcom feeds on Thu, 02/09/2010 - 9:09pm.Tenants in Poland are celebrating the first successful grassroots campaign to prevent the sell-off of publicly owned housing.
The grassroots fighting organization, the Tenants' Defense Committee, managed to stop the privatization of a house on Targowa St. in Warsaw. This is an historic moment: as far as we know, this is the first privatization in Poland that has been successfully stopped by protest!

New Zealand: Mana Coach Services Strike
Submitted by libcom feeds on Thu, 02/09/2010 - 3:29am.Mana Coaches Picket Paraparaumu 31st Aug 2010 002.jpg
On August 31st drivers employed by Mana Coach Services went on strike at the depot outside Paraparaumu Station, an hour north of Wellington, New Zealand. The workers took the strike action after the company refused to budge on wage rates, despite the Tramways Union reaching a settlement of 11.5% over two years with two other companies in Wellington.

BBC staff vote for strike action
Submitted by libcom feeds on Wed, 01/09/2010 - 4:47pm.BBC staff members have voted in favour of strike action in a dispute over pensions.
Bectu and the National Union of Journalists said more than 90% of members had voted for a walk out.
But the unions said the decision on whether to strike would be postponed for two weeks while it discussed alternative proposals with the BBC.
In June, the BBC announced plans to overhaul its pension scheme to try and tackle a £2bn deficit.

Miners to join South African public sector strike
Submitted by libcom feeds on Fri, 27/08/2010 - 12:07pm.Miners in South Africa plan to join the massive public sector strike that has already crippled the the government in recent weeks.
The National Union of Mineworkers said Friday it will join the public sector strike next week if the government does not meet the demands of strikers who want more money.

Garment and construction workers strikes in Cambodia
Submitted by libcom feeds on Tue, 24/08/2010 - 1:36pm.In the past few days, a garment workers' strike has found itself in conflict with bosses, local authorities and union officials while last week, construction workers struck in solidarity with sacked workmates.
Around 160 garment workers continued to strike on Monday (22nd August) outside the gates of a factory in Meanchey district, where they have camped out day and night since Thursday to agitate for improved working conditions.
